Dwell with Dignity’s Thrift Studio features top Dallas designers

A 30-day pop-up shop featuring luxury room vignettes created by top interior designers and select retailers, the Thrift Studio will make its way to the Dallas Design Center October 10 – November 9, offering deeply-discounted product to benefit the future work, growth, organization and structure of Dwell with Dignity's non-profit projects.

This year’s honorary chair is interior and product designer Jan Showers, and retail and designer participants include Horchow, Cody Hutcheson of Codarus, Katie Reynolds of Lilli Design, Leslie Pritchard of Again & Again, Neal Stewart of Neal Stewart Designs, Sherry Hayslip of Hayslip Design Associates and Todd Fiscus of Todd Events.

The VIP preview party takes place on Thursday, October 10 at 6:00 p.m. followed by the preview party at 7:00 p.m. Tickets are available online starting September 3.

The pop-up store officially opens on Friday, October 11 and will remain open through November 9. Hours are Tuesday through Saturday from 10:00 a.m. to 5:30 p.m.

Dwell with Dignity is a non-profit group of interior designers and volunteers dedicated to creating soothing, inspiring homes for families struggling with homelessness and poverty. It provides and installs home interiors for families that include furnishings and art, bedding and kitchen supplies, and food in the pantry.
